AES128 vs AES256

Գաղտնագրման առաջադեմ ստանդարտ (Գաղտնագրման առաջադեմ ստանդարտ, հապավում: AES), Այս ստանդարտը օգտագործվում է բնօրինակ DES- ը փոխարինելու համար եւ լայնորեն օգտագործվում է ամբողջ աշխարհում.

AES- ը կարող է արագորեն կոդավորել եւ ապակոդավորել ծրագրակազմում եւ ապարատներում, համեմատաբար հեշտ է իրականացնել, եւ պահանջում է միայն փոքր քանակությամբ հիշողություն. Այն ներկայումս տեղակայված է ավելի լայն տեսականի.

  1. Որոնք են AES128- ի եւ AES256- ի հիմնական տարբերությունը եւ անվտանգության մակարդակը?
  2. Ինչ է նրանց սպառումը մեքենայի վրա?
  3. Որն է երկուսի կատարումը?
  4. Ինչպես ընտրել իրական զարգացման համար?

AES- ը շատ արագ է համեմատած սիմետրիկ կոդավորման նմանատիպ ալգորիթմների հետ. Օրինակ, AES-NI- ով X86 սերվերը գոնե կարող է հասնել մի քանի հարյուր մ / վ արագության. Անվտանգությունը հիմնականում համարժեք է տեսանելի ապագայի համար, քանի որ նույնիսկ 128-բիթը բավականաչափ բարդ է, որպեսզի չլինի դաժանորեն. Ներկայումս, 112-BIT գաղտնաբառերը դեռ առեւտրային օգտագործման մեջ են, իսկ 128-բիթը տասնյակ հազարավոր անգամներ է 112-բիթանոցով, Այսպիսով, դա ավելի ծախսարդյունավետ է գործնականում 128-բիթանոց օգտագործելը (Մի փոքր խնայում են ռեսուրսները).

AES256- ը տանում է 40% Ավելի շատ ժամանակ, քան AES128- ը, Լրացուցիչի համար 4 Կլոր ստեղնաշարի սերնդի եւ համապատասխան SPN գործողության փուլերը. Ի հավելումն, 256-բիթանոց ստեղների ստեղծումը կարող է պահանջել նաեւ ավելի քան 128 բիթանոց ստեղներ, Բայց գլխավերեւի այս մասը պետք է աննշան լինի.


Անվտանգության աստիճանը, բնականաբար, AES256- ն ավելի անվտանգ է, քան AES128- ը, քանի որ ներկայումս չկա շատ արդյունավետ հանրահաշվական հարձակման մեթոդ, բացառությամբ դաժան ուժերի ճեղքման.


AES-256 կամ AES-128- ի հատուկ ծրագրային ապահովման / ապարատային իրականացման հատուկ մեթոդներ կան, Այնպես որ, ընդհանրացնելը հեշտ չէ.

Ժամանակակից Գաղտնագրությունը բաժանված է սիմետրիկ կոդավորման եւ ասիմետրիկ կոդավորման (Հանրային բանալիների կոդավորումը), Եվ ներկայացուցչական ալգորիթմներն են (այժմ մշակվել է 3DES- ի մեջ), AES, եւ RSA. Ասիմետրիկ կոդավորման ալգորիթմների ռեսուրսների սպառումը ավելի մեծ է, քան սիմետրիկ կոդավորումը. ընդհանրապես, Կատարվում է հիբրիդ կոդավորման վերամշակում, օրինակ, RSA- ն օգտագործվում է հիմնական բաշխման եւ բանակցությունների համար, եւ AES- ն օգտագործվում է բիզնեսի տվյալների գաղտնագրման եւ գաղտնագրման համար.

Որոշ նկարներ, որոնք կապված են կոդավորման եւ գաղտնագրման որոշ սիմետրիկ եւ ասիմետրիկ ալգորիթմների հետ:

AES128 vs AES256 1
AES128 VS AES256
AES128 vs AES256 2
AES128 VS AES256
AES128 vs AES256 3
AES128 VS AES256

Ինչ վերաբերում է AES128- ը կամ AES256 ալգորիթմը օգտագործել, Ես անձամբ կարծում եմ, որ AES128- ը բավարար է, իհարկե, AES256- ը կարող է օգտագործվել որպես շուկայավարման գործիք.

Հարց տվեք

← Ետ

Ձեր հաղորդագրությունն ուղարկված է